SKINOPSIS

Argento's sequel to Suspiria is an almost incomprehensible collection of bizarre images and fantastically realized setpiece murders. It lacks a linear narrative, but that does not detract from its overall ambiance of weirdness and terror. A young American poet discovers a book which she believes identifies her ancient New York apartment building as the residence of the Mater Tenebrarum, the mother of shadows, one of three witches who generate all the misery in the world. The first mother, Mater Suspiriorum, lives in Freiburg and was the subject of Argento's Suspiria. Inferno is full of stylistic touches which overcome its narrative difficulties. Suspiria and Inferno are the only two films Argento has made with purely supernatural plots, a fact which gives him the freedom to completely abandon all logic and submerge himself in the stylish, horrifying impulses which make him unique among horror film directors.
